What are the common contaminants in a crime scene situation?
Common contaminants include blood, bodily fluids, chemicals, particulate matter, and potentially infectious agents.
Why is crime scene cleanup necessary?
It prevents the spread of infectious diseases, mitigates health risks, and ensures that affected areas can be safely reoccupied after a traumatic incident.

What are the psychological effects of hoarding?
Hoarding has significant psychological effects, including anxiety, depression, and social isolation. Many individuals experience extreme stress when faced with the idea of discarding items, leading to avoidance behaviors. Hoarding can also affect self-esteem and cause conflicts with family members. Over time, the emotional burden can become overwhelming, making it difficult to seek help. Professional hoarding cleanup services provide a compassionate approach to decluttering, often working alongside therapists to support clients through the emotional aspects of the cleanup process.

Why is professional blood cleanup necessary?
Blood can carry pathogens like HIV, Hepatitis B, and Hepatitis C, posing serious health risks. Professional cleanup ensures proper decontamination, compliance with legal regulations, and peace of mind for those affected by the incident.
